Miracle House exists to care for the children who need the most help.

Providing, food, clothing, shelter and an education we are raising up the next generation of leaders who will be motivated by the loving heart of God. Miracle House Kenya exists to provide education, food, clothing, LOVE for the neediest children in a safe family environment. We care for children from preschool through university or trade school, bringing them up to become the leaders of the next generation.

On Tuesday we travelled from Webuye to Nakuru, directly to MH Base Camp, where we met Julius, the drilling contractor and our MHBC Site Coordinator - Apostle David. The test pump team was expecting us. They had already gone down with the camera to record and reveal what’s at the bottom of the borehole.
We knew the drilling had been extended to approx. 310 meters. We arrived to a rather somber group; we wondered what we were about to hear. After greetings and introductions, we gathered around the small screen to see the live video of what’s below…
Remarkable journey, you can see the casings, the moisture on them as you go deeper…
At 266 m casing stops and solid rock begins - with drilled hole 6-inch (15 cm) wide, with fractures.
Then at 295-303 m - WATER! At first - a bit cloudy, but as we went deeper it got clear. Not just an aquifer - it’s actually a moving RIVER, 8 meters (26 ft) deep. Just imagine the abundance💧 This is our God gift - from Faithful, Generous, God of Abundance! ✨🙌🏼✨

On Friday, the casing for the borehole has been put all the way down to 270 meters, where the drillers hit rock. Some pieces of the casing are solid and some are permeable to allow water flow. Right now, our drilling team is pressure-cleaning the casing from the inside, with some challenges on the way (broken equipment that needed to be replaced). On Saturday morning we’ll have a measuring pump to determine yield of water from different depths and to help check quality of water.

Tuesday morning we arrived early at the Base Camp. We spent time worshipping our Way Maker, prayed and anointed the machinery.
Eight 5-meter rods were drilled in before a hydraulic hose burst💥 which slowed down otherwise very efficient progress.
We still need to put down approximately 42 of these rods for the depth of 250meters.
The drilling team fixed the machine and they are confident about reaching water level on Wednesday.

We thought you would like to ‘experience’ a food post.
First of all: these kids eat twice-three times what you would expect!
MH menu schedule, both in Limuru and Webuye, is consistent week to week. We enjoy lots of local greens and grains and we are blessed to say, MH also provides meat and other proteins.

When our children are in high school, they begin the GIVE-BACK PROGRAM. They share in the household responsibilities - cooking, cleaning, helping with shopping… they keep track of their hours, similar to ‘Community Service’ volunteerism in the US. This is considered when the children apply for Miracle House Scholarships to attend college or university.
We do everyday family life together: food prep, cooking, cleaning, laundry. Helping younger ones - sometimes even little ones from our neighborhood, as they are eager to join and check out what we’re doing. We share in leading worship and prayer.
